Our client is seeking an Electronics Test Technician to join their team, responsible for building, testing, and calibrating PCBs for their product lines. This role is crucial for ensuring products meet specifications and for driving continuous improvement in processes. Working within a small team, collaboration and effective communication are essential. The ideal candidate will have a HNC in electrical/electronics engineering and have 5 years' experience in a production environment building and testing PCBs.
Day-to-day of the role:- Build various stages of assemblies and solder to IPC standards (training provided).
- Recognise electronic components such as capacitors and resistors.
- Understand electrical wiring and mechanical drawings.
- Utilise tools like CRO (Cathode Ray Oscilloscope) and DVM (Digital Volt Meter).
- Familiarity with a range of hand tools.
- Conduct tests according to in-house specifications and ensure timely completion of product testing.
- Manage your own time effectively and be involved in continuous improvements.
- Maintain accurate records of all builds and tests.
- Adhere to high health and safety standards and work within an Electrostatic Protected Area (EPA).
